Banner

My Tech Blog (분산처리)

오늘의 명언
1. 서버 이중화(Duplication, Duplex) 서버 이중화는 고가용성(High Availability, HA)을 확보하기 위해 두 대 이상의 서버를 물리적 또는 논리적으로 구성하는 기술이다. 이는 시스템 장애 발생 시, 서비스의 중단 없이 지속적인 운영을 보장하기 위한 전략으로, 주로 클러스터링, 로드 밸런싱, 또는 리던던시(중복 구성) 방식으로 구현된다. 이중화 방식은 일반적으로 한쪽만이 동작하다가 장애 발생 시 다른 한 쪽이 동작을 이어가는 형태이다. 단, 중요도가 낮은 트래픽이 흐르는 장비는 이중화로 충분하지만, 중요한 데이터를 저장해야 하는 서버나 스토리지라면 삼중화, 사중화(다중화)시키기도 한다. (예: 은행 시스템 등) 물리적 서버 이중화는 두 개 이상의 물리적 서버를 사용하여 장애가..
서버 이중화와 분산 처리는 고가용성과 안정성을 확보하기 위해 필수적이다. 단일 서버로는 대량의 트래픽과 장애 발생 시 복구를 감당할 수 없기 때문에, 다수의 서버로 부하를 분산하고 백업 시스템을 마련해야 한다. 특히, 이커머스나 금융 서비스처럼 실시간 처리가 중요한 환경에서는 자동 확장(Auto Scaling)과 무중단 운영이 필수적이다.1. 서버 이중화 (Server Redundancy)서버 이중화는 장애 대비(High Availability, HA - 고가용성)를 위한 개념이다.하나의 서버가 다운되더라도 다른 서버가 대신 역할을 수행할 수 있도록 백업 서버를 준비하는 방식이다.  ✔️ 예를 들면?DB 서버 이중화: Master-Slave 구조웹 서버 이중화: 로드밸런서 + 두 개의 동일한 웹 서버 ✔..
상단으로